Briefing: Second-Source Supplier Search — Leadership Review

For the sales leads: we are qualifying a second source for the Korvex actuator line, currently single-sourced from Deltrane Components. Two candidates, Fennick Precision and Ashgate Works, are in trial production. Expect no customer-facing changes before qualification completes. The commercial motivation is summarized in the confidential note that follows.

board note of kageg-bahof: The renewal with Holwynax Holdings closes at $2 million a year, 5 percent below the last contract. Project Ulaath slips by two quarters because of the supplier delay.

Welcome to the Lanternleaf consent banner program. Plugin authors must register each banner variant before rollout so the Driftgate compliance checker can validate copy, locale coverage, and dismissal behavior. Please test against the staging consent ledger rather than production; consent records are immutable once written, and malformed entries cannot be purged without a formal review. To connect your local plugin harness to the staging ledger, configure your client with the connection string below.

replica DSN, hadug-yajep: postgresql://aldiel_svc:W4u8z42Jo5IFtG@db-1656.torvacorp.local:5432/holael

## Step 3: Update your plugin's configuration assumptions

MeasureCraft 5 changes how the scaling engine resolves unit tables, and plugins that read host settings directly must adopt the new keys. Do not hard-code the legacy paths; they are removed, not deprecated. Test against a local instance before publishing to the Orchard plugin registry. A standard development instance should be started with the following configuration.

deployment values, fafog-fawip:
[jorox]
team = fendor
access_code = ac_bb00ea
host = jorox.qorveltech.internal
port = 9200
owner = istdor.aldeth
peer = julvan.orvexlabs.internal